MINUTES OF THE MEETING OF OUTWOOD PARISH COUNCIL HELD ON TUESDAY 4TH MARCH 2025 AT THE LLOYD HALL, BRICKFIELD ROAD, OUTWOOD AT 7.30PM
PRESENT: Cllrs. De Wiggondene-Sheppard (Chair), Devlin, Baldock, Malley and McIntosh
APOLOGIES: County Cllr. C Farr, District Cllrs. Bolton and Smith
IN ATTENDANCE: The Clerk and 6 Members of the Public
PUBLIC QUESTIONS AND COMMENTS
Mr Blackmore from Salfords and Sidlow Parish Council apprised Members of the revised structure of the Redhill Aerodrome Consultative Committee and asked if Outwood PC would be willing to have a representative on this Committee. Cllr McIntosh volunteered represent Outwood PC.

03/1104 CONFIRMATION OF REPRESENTATION ON RACC (AS ABOVE)
It was proposed by Cllr. Devlin and seconded by Cllr Baldock that Cllr. McIntosh represent Outwood PC on the Redhill Aerodrome Consultative Committee. SO RESOLVED

03/1109 GUIDE TO SURREY COUNTY COUNCIL HIGHWAYS – This had been circulated to all Members. It was AGREED that Cllr. McIntosh take over the Highways interest for the Parish Council with Cllr. Devlin taking on Footpaths. SO RESOLVED
